About this role

MongoDB’s Storage Layer Services (SLS) team is re-architecting the MongoDB cloud storage layer and sits at the heart of our next-generation cloud storage architecture. This relatively new team is building performant, multi-tenant distributed storage services that both enhance today’s Atlas storage stack and enable more customer workloads to run more efficiently.

As the Site Reliability Engineering Manager for SLS, you will partner with the teams building these storage services to define SLOs, shape capacity plans, and ensure the reliability, durability, and operational safety of the storage layer that underpins Atlas. You’ll help grow and lead a small, senior team of SREs as founding members of this organization, playing a crucial role in executing on a multi-year roadmap for MongoDB’s cloud storage architecture.

Responsibilities

  • Build and lead a team of 6-8 engineers, fostering a positive culture, handling career growth and performance conversations, and proactively removing blockers
  • Define and drive a clear technical vision and comprehensive roadmap for our multi-tenant distributed storage systems, balancing long-term strategic infrastructure goals with immediate engineering needs
  • Contribute through hands-on technical work, such as leading architectural design reviews, reviewing PRs, and stepping in to guide the team through complex operational challenges
  • Act as the primary liaison for the Storage Layer Services SRE team, collaborating closely with other engineering leaders to ensure platform alignment and manage stakeholder expectations

You may be a good fit if you

  • Have 10+ years of experience working on software and operating distributed systems, with 2+ years managing engineering teams
  • Possess a customer-focused mindset, treating internal developers as your primary users
  • Value efficiency in processes and operations, and have a track record of optimizing team workflows
  • Prefer automation over manual processes, fostering a culture of building software solutions to eliminate toil
  • Have deep technical familiarity with Kubernetes ecosystems, containerization technologies, and modern IaC tooling (e.g., Terraform, Crossplane, or Operators) so you can effectively guide the team's technical decisions
  • Have operated or supported stateful storage or database systems at scale and are comfortable with durability, consistency and recovery trade-offs
  • Excel at translating complex business and engineering requirements into actionable, phased technical roadmaps
  • Have a high level of empathy, responsibility, ownership, and accountability
  • Excellent verbal and written technical communication skills

Strong candidates may also have experience with

  • Leading major architectural shifts, such as moving from legacy storage stacks to new multi-tenant storage architectures, including planning and executing large-scale data and workload migrations with tight availability and durability requirements
  • Managing and scaling infrastructure across multi-cloud environments (AWS, GCP, or Azure)
  • Designing secure, multi-tenant runtime environments at scale
